Flats For Rent in Peshawar
Several areas in Peshawar offer excellent rental flats with different features and price ranges. Hayatabad, DHA Peshawar, and University Town are some of the most sought-after locations due to their peaceful environment, proximity to essential services, and high security. Saddar and Cantt are also popular choices for those who prefer to live in central areas with easy access to commercial hubs.

Rental Prices of Flats in Peshawar
The rent for flats in Peshawar varies depending on the location, size, and amenities provided. A studio flat in a standard area may cost around PKR 15,000 to 30,000 per month, while a one-bedroom flat ranges between PKR 25,000 to 50,000. Two-bedroom flats generally cost between PKR 40,000 to 80,000, while luxury three-bedroom apartments in prime locations can go up to PKR 150,000 per month.
Furnished vs. Unfurnished Flats
Renters can choose between furnished and unfurnished flats based on their needs and budget. Furnished flats come with essential furniture, kitchen appliances, and other necessities, making them ideal for short-term stays. Unfurnished flats, on the other hand, are more affordable and allow tenants to decorate according to their preferences, making them a better choice for long-term rentals.

Legal Considerations Before Renting
Before finalizing a rental flat, it is crucial to understand the legal aspects. A written rental agreement should be signed, mentioning important details such as rent amount, security deposit, maintenance responsibilities, and lease duration. It is advisable to check the landlord’s background, confirm property ownership, and inspect the flat thoroughly before moving in.

What is the security deposit for rental flats in Peshawar?
Most landlords require a security deposit equivalent to one to three months’ rent, which is refundable at the end of the tenancy period.
